We're working with SES Engineering Services (SES) to support recruitment for
mechanical and electrical trades to work on Teesside's new monopile factory in
construction for SeAH Wind.
Once complete the new structure, visible across the Teesworks site, will become the world's biggest monopile factory - with the capacity to produce up to 200 offshore wind turbine monopiles each year.
It's a significant feat of engineering to bring the 40m tall factory to life, and NRL are working with SES to engage temporary contractors across a range of M&E disciplines to support the project.
